Munich | 14-Nov-2017 | Broadcast and Media Rohde & Schwarz and SiTune successfully test the new Japanese ultra high-definition ISDB-S3 standard SiTune Corporation, manufacturer of RF and mixed signal semiconductors, silicon tuners enabling triple-play, satellite and terrestrial / cable receivers, has successfully tested its tuners for 8K Ultra High-Definition satellite TV in line with the ISDB-S3 standard. The R&S SLG satellite load generator from Rohde & Schwarz generated the ISDB-S3 signals. It is the first signal generator with this capability. In the interoperability test, the SiTune STN6528 tuner successfully received and demodulated the ISDB-S3 signal. The SiTune STN6528 tuner was operated as a plug-in board on an SC1501 demodulator evaluation board from Socionext. From November 15 to 17, the test setup will be displayed together with the R&S SLG at the SiTune booth 3302 at the Inter BEE trade fair in Japan. In preparation for the Olympic Games 2020 in Tokyo, the Japanese broadcasting world is getting ready for 8K UHDTV. In 2018, public broadcaster NHK will roll out the needed ISDB-S3 standard. SiTune already introduced the worlds first ISDB-S3 tuner in January 2016. By the second quarter of 2018, the manufacturer will start mass production of the tuner, which supports satellite, terrestrial and cable reception.
The multichannel R&S SLG signal generator from Rohde & Schwarz was used for the tests. The R&S SLG simultaneously generates up to 32 satellite transponders in realtime. This extremely compact 1 HU, 19 unit replaces a full rack of many separate signal generators. Users save energy and space, and eliminate the time-consuming, error-prone operation of multiple instruments as well as the cost of servicing and calibrating them. The R&S SLG can be operated in the 250 MHz to 3225 MHz frequency range with a modulation bandwidth of 500 MHz. Customers have a choice of transmission standards, including DVB-S, DSNG, DVB-S2, DVB-S2 wideband, DVB-S2X (also with channel bonding), ISDB-S and ISDB-S3. Several R&S SLG generators can be cascaded to generate signals for the entire satellite IF band. In multicarrier operation, the R&S SLG generates up to 32 transponder signals and transmits the content of transport streams that are fed into the instrument via an ASI, Gigabit Ethernet or optical SFP+ interface via IP.
The R&S SLG is ideal for developing and testing set-top boxes and tuners in the consumer equipment industry as well as for testing professional satellite terminals, terrestrial satellite station receivers and components, and for satellite payloads in the aerospace and defense industry. Satellite operators use the R&S SLG to simulate transponders and for tests to optimize transmissions.

Rohde & Schwarz The Rohde & Schwarz technology group develops, produces and markets innovative information and communications technology products for professional users. Rohde & Schwarz focuses on test and measurement, broadcast and media, cybersecurity, secure communications and monitoring and network testing, areas that address many different industry and government-sector market segments. Founded more than 80 years ago, the independent company has an extensive sales and service network in more than 70 countries. On June 30, 2017, Rohde & Schwarz had approximately 10,500 employees. The group achieved a net revenue of approximately EUR 1.9 billion in the 2016/2017 fiscal year (July to June). The company is headquartered in Munich, Germany, and also has regional hubs in Asia and the USA.R&S is a registered trademark of Rohde & Schwarz GmbH & Co.KG.
